Sony Xperia XZ2 Premium is slightly better than the Galaxy A20s, getting a score of 82.2 against 77. Although it's the best cellphone in our current comparison, it must be told that it's also an older, way thicker and notably heavier cellphone. The Sony Xperia XZ2 Premium has a way better looking display than Galaxy A20s, because although it has a little bit smaller screen, it also counts with a way better resolution of 2160 x 3840 and a lot greater pixels number per inch of display.
The Samsung Galaxy A20s counts with just a bit bigger storage capacity to store more apps and games than Sony Xperia XZ2 Premium, and although they both have equal internal storage capacity, the Samsung Galaxy A20s also has a slot for an external memory card that holds up to 512 GB. Xperia XZ2 Premium counts with a bit faster processor than Samsung Galaxy A20s, and although they both have a Octa-Core CPU, the Xperia XZ2 Premium also has a greater amount of RAM memory.
Galaxy A20s counts with a little better battery life than Xperia XZ2 Premium, because it has 4000mAh of battery capacity. Xperia XZ2 Premium counts with a better camera than Galaxy A20s, and although they both have a F1.8 camera aperture, the Xperia XZ2 Premium also has a lot higher 3840x2160 (4K) video resolution, a back facing camera with a way higher 19 megapixels resolution and a lot larger back camera sensor shooting way better quality pictures.
